- Abstract
The first record of the giant fireflies Aspisoma ignitum (Linnæus, 1767) (Coleoptera: Lampyridae: Lampyrinae, Cratomorphini) in the city of Coro, semiarid region of Falcon state, north-western Venezuela, is presented. So far, this appears as the northernmost report of A. ignitum in Venezuela. The importance of lampyrid giant fireflies as potential biological agents to control pests of agricultural and sanitary interest is discussed.
